Visitor Center: T-Rex and Raptor Attack

This set recreates the iconic scene at the Jurassic Park Visitor Center, where the T-Rex and Raptor wreak havoc. With 693 pieces, it includes figures of Alan Grant, Ellie Sattler, Lex Murphy, Tim Murphy, and a security guard. It also brings a buildable T-Rex and Velociraptor. The visitor center features a genetics lab, a fossil showroom, and an accurately detailed kitchen.

The attention to detail on this set is impressive, faithfully recreating the tense and exciting atmosphere of the movie. It’s perfect for fans who want a spectacular centerpiece for their collection.

2. Dilophosaurus ambush

This 211-piece set depicts the scene where Dennis Nedry is attacked by the Dilophosaurus. It includes mini figures of Dennis Nedry and a security guard, as well as a Dilophosaurus. In addition, it comes with a detailed jeep and an “East” and “West” sign that is crucial in the scene.

It’s a compact but action-packed set that captures one of the most memorable and dramatic moments from the movie. Ideal for those looking to add a touch of Jurassic Park to their collection without taking up too much space.

3. Velociraptor Escape

With 137 pieces, this set recreates the tense Velociraptor escape scene. Includes mini figures of Ellie Sattler and Robert Muldoon, and a buildable Velociraptor. The set features a section of the Velociraptor cage with escape features.

This set is perfect for recreating the adrenaline rush of the Velociraptor escape. The details of the cage and mini figures allow you to relive this exciting scene with precision.

4. Discovery of Brachiosaurus

With 512 pieces, this set captures the wonderful scene of the first Brachiosaurus encounter. It includes mini figures of Alan Grant, Ellie Sattler and John Hammond, as well as an impressive buildable Brachiosaurus. The set also comes with a jeep and a tree that the dinosaur can eat.

Brachiosaurus is one of the most beloved dinosaurs from Jurassic Park, and this set allows you to recreate that magical first encounter. It’s a must-have addition for any fan of the saga.

5. Triceratops research

This 281-piece set includes figures of Alan Grant, Ellie Sattler and a caretaker, plus a buildable Triceratops. Also includes a jeep and a dung pile with hidden details. Depicts the scene where the main characters investigate a sick Triceratops.

The Triceratops scene is one of the most iconic and emotional scenes from the movie. This set allows fans to recreate that poignant moment and add a classic dinosaur to their collection.
